Changeset 707
- Timestamp:
- 06/29/08 07:40:35 (6 months ago)
- Location:
- trunk
- Files:
-
- 4 modified
-
SConstruct (modified) (2 diffs)
-
bindings/python/SConscript (modified) (2 diffs)
-
plugins/input/postgis/SConscript (modified) (1 diff)
-
plugins/input/shape/SConscript (modified) (1 diff)
Legend:
- Unmodified
- Added
- Removed
-
trunk/SConstruct
r703 r707 155 155 156 156 BOOST_LIBSHEADERS = [ 157 #['system', 'boost/system/system_error.hpp', True], # uncomment this on Darwin + boost_1_35157 ['system', 'boost/system/system_error.hpp', True], # uncomment this on Darwin + boost_1_35 158 158 ['filesystem', 'boost/filesystem/operations.hpp', True], 159 159 ['regex', 'boost/regex.hpp', True], … … 182 182 for count, libinfo in enumerate(BOOST_LIBSHEADERS): 183 183 if env['THREADING'] == 'multi' : 184 if not conf.CheckLibWithHeader('boost_%s%s%s' % (libinfo[0], env['BOOST_APPEND'],thread_suffix), libinfo[1], 'C++') and libinfo[2] :184 if not conf.CheckLibWithHeader('boost_%s%s%s' % (libinfo[0],thread_suffix,env['BOOST_APPEND']), libinfo[1], 'C++') and libinfo[2] : 185 185 color_print(1,'Could not find header or shared library for boost %s, exiting!' % libinfo[0]) 186 186 Exit(1) -
trunk/bindings/python/SConscript
r703 r707 41 41 libraries = ['mapnik','png','jpeg'] 42 42 if env['THREADING'] == 'multi': 43 libraries.append('boost_python%s%s' % ( env['BOOST_APPEND'],thread_suffix))43 libraries.append('boost_python%s%s' % (thread_suffix,env['BOOST_APPEND'])) 44 44 else : 45 45 libraries.append('boost_python%s' % env['BOOST_APPEND']) … … 49 49 libraries.append('icudata') 50 50 if env['THREADING'] == 'multi': 51 libraries.append('boost_regex%s%s' % ( env['BOOST_APPEND'],thread_suffix))51 libraries.append('boost_regex%s%s' % (thread_suffix,env['BOOST_APPEND'])) 52 52 else : 53 53 libraries.append('boost_regex%s' % env['BOOST_APPEND']) 54 54 if env['THREADING'] == 'multi': 55 libraries.append('boost_thread%s%s' % ( env['BOOST_APPEND'],thread_suffix))55 libraries.append('boost_thread%s%s' % (thread_suffix,env['BOOST_APPEND'])) 56 56 if '-DHAVE_PYCAIRO' in env['CXXFLAGS']: 57 57 libraries.append([lib for lib in env['LIBS'] if lib.startswith('cairo')]) -
trunk/plugins/input/postgis/SConscript
r703 r707 39 39 libraries.append('icudata') 40 40 if env['THREADING'] == 'multi': 41 libraries.append('boost_thread %s-mt' % env['BOOST_APPEND'])41 libraries.append('boost_thread-mt%s' % env['BOOST_APPEND']) 42 42 43 43 postgis_inputdriver = env.SharedLibrary('postgis', source=postgis_src, SHLIBPREFIX='', SHLIBSUFFIX='.input', LIBS=libraries) -
trunk/plugins/input/shape/SConscript
r703 r707 41 41 42 42 if env['THREADING'] == 'multi': 43 libraries = ['boost_iostreams%s%s' % ( env['BOOST_APPEND'],thread_suffix) ]43 libraries = ['boost_iostreams%s%s' % (thread_suffix,env['BOOST_APPEND']) ] 44 44 else: 45 45 libraries = ['boost_iostreams%s' % (env['BOOST_APPEND']) ]
